Air India Flight AI 174: The Aviation Connection
Let’s start with the most prominent meaning. AI 174 is a regularly scheduled Air India flight operating between San Francisco International Airport and Delhi’s Indira Gandhi International Airport. The flight covers approximately 12,352 kilometers and typically takes 16 hours and 45 minutes. It operates three times weekly using a Boeing 777 aircraft.
This flight made headlines in November 2025 when it experienced a midair technical glitch and made a precautionary landing at Mongolia’s New Ulaanbaatar International Airport. All 225 passengers onboard were safe. The aircraft had flown for over ten hours when the cockpit crew suspected a technical issue. Air India described it as a precautionary diversion rather than an emergency landing.
A relief flight eventually brought passengers and crew back to Delhi. The Indian Embassy in Mongolia and local authorities provided swift assistance to all 228 passengers and crew members. Air India thanked local authorities, the Indian Embassy, the DGCA, and the Government of India for their support during the incident.
Key Facts About Air India Flight AI 174:
- Route: San Francisco (SFO) to Delhi (DEL)
- Distance: 12,352 km
- Duration: 16 hours 45 minutes
- Frequency: 3 times weekly
- Aircraft: Boeing 777
- Notable Incident: Precautionary landing in Mongolia (November 2025)
AIM-174B: The Military Missile Making Headlines
The second major meaning of “AI 174” connects to a powerful US Navy weapon. The AIM-174B is a long-range air-to-air missile developed by Raytheon for the United States Navy. It’s essentially a modified version of the naval RIM-174 Standard ERAM (Standard Extended Range Active Missile) adapted for fighter jet launch.
This missile represents a significant upgrade from its predecessors. It’s often called the “Phoenix II” or the successor to the AIM-54 Phoenix, which was retired in 2004. The AIM-174 is approximately five times heavier than the AIM-120 AMRAAM, weighing about 861 kg.
Technical Specifications of AIM-174B:
| Specification | Value |
|---|---|
| Length | 4.7 meters |
| Diameter | 0.34 meters |
| Wingspan | 1.57 meters |
| Weight | 861 kg |
| Warhead Weight | 64 kg |
| Maximum Speed | Mach 3.5 (4,287.7 km/h) |
| Range | ~240 km |
| Guidance | Active and semi-active radar, inertial, data link |
The missile uses a solid-fuel rocket motor and can engage targets using multiple guidance systems, including inertial guidance, active and semi-active radar homing, and data link for precision targeting. Some experts claim the AIM-174B could engage targets at ranges exceeding 460 km when launched from high altitude, though the US Navy officially states the range is around 240 km.
The AIM-174B was publicly revealed in July 2024 during the RIMPAC exercise. The only confirmed launch platform is the Boeing F/A-18 Super Hornet. This missile is America’s answer to recent Russian and Chinese developments like the Vympel R-37 and the PL-21.
Why This Missile Matters:
- Countering Foreign Threats: China and Russia have deployed long-range air-to-air missiles exceeding 200 km range
- Carrier Defense: Restores long-range interception capability lost when the F-14 and AIM-54 retired
- Versatility: Can potentially engage ground and sea targets, inheriting SM-6’s multirole capability
- Cost-Effective: Shares 98%+ components with the already-in-production SM-6, with over 500 missiles deployed and 1,800+ ordered
174 AI Business Scenarios: The Corporate AI Revolution
In the business world, “AI 174” represents a compelling success story from China. SAI 2.0, an AI transformation initiative at Seres Group (a Chinese automotive manufacturer), produced 174 AI application scenarios in just five months.
Seres partnered with Feishu (the Chinese version of Lark) to launch SAI 2.0 in December 2025. The goal was to build a true AI-first organization where AI becomes part of everyday work rather than just a corporate directive. The results were remarkable.
How It Worked:
- Employees across the organization participated in an “AI Pioneer” contest
- Non-technical workers built AI solutions using Feishu’s multidimensional tables and limited AI capabilities
- One quality assurance team leader built a comprehensive quality platform in just seven days
The 174 AI Scenes Breakdown:
| Scenario Category | Example | Impact |
|---|---|---|
| Supplier Dimension Chain Review | AI pre-audits supplier data | 85% accuracy, 53% efficiency improvement |
| Technical Document Review | AI reviews technical files | Coverage from 5% to 100%, 50,000+ hours saved annually |
| Production Line Inspection | Digital patrol robots | Anomaly detection from 2 hours to 5 minutes |
| EHS (Environment, Health, Safety) | Hearing health monitoring | Prevention of occupational hearing loss |
| Product Planning | Competitor vehicle analysis | Data-driven R&D insights |
The Numbers That Matter:
- Activation Rate: 100%
- Daily AI Usage: 173 minutes per person
- Active AI Users: 7,500+ employees daily
- AI Activity Rate: 23% of employees actively using AI tools
Seres’ experience shows that the 174 AI scenarios represent “174 groups of people, 174 perspectives, 174 business pain points” solving their own problems. The key insight: building an AI organization isn’t about IT projects—it’s about AI becoming everyone’s working style.
AMD Ryzen AI Embedded P174: The Hardware Angle
For tech enthusiasts and hardware engineers, “AI 174” points to a processor. The AMD Ryzen AI Embedded P174 is a system-on-chip (SoC) designed for embedded applications. It integrates Zen 5 processing architecture with RDNA graphics and XDNA AI acceleration.
Key Specifications of AMD Ryzen AI Embedded P174:
| Specification | Detail |
|---|---|
| CPU Cores | 10 cores, 20 threads |
| Max Frequency | 5 GHz |
| L3 Cache | 24 MB |
| TDP | 28W (configurable 15-54W) |
| NPU Performance | Up to 50 TOPS |
| Memory Support | DDR5-5600, LPDDR5x-8533 |
| GPU | AMD Radeon Graphics, 12 CUs, up to 2800 MHz |
| Display Support | 4 displays, up to 7680×4320 at 60Hz |
This processor supports up to 50 TOPS (trillion operations per second) of AI performance, making it suitable for industrial automation, robotics, edge computing, and other embedded applications requiring AI acceleration. AMD recommends it for new designs and offers support until 2036.
The 174-Meter AI Digital Artwork: Art Meets Technology
In a spectacular fusion of AI and art, a 174-meter AI-generated digital artwork debuted at the 15th National Games of China in November 2025. This massive piece was created by Shenzhen-based DeepYuan Artificial Intelligence using their proprietary MasterAgent system, the world’s first L4-level intelligent agent mother system.
The Scale of This Achievement:
- Length: 174 meters of continuous digital artwork
- Display: 9 circular screens working together
- AI Creation: Over 99% of the artwork was AI-generated
- Agent Team: 2,000+ intelligent agents were deployed
How It Was Made:
MasterAgent generated over 2,000 intelligent agents that split into two specialized teams:
- Cultural Research Team: Focused on Lingnan history, culture, and heritage
- Artistic Style Team: Analyzed thousands of classical Chinese and Western oil paintings
The AI used convolutional neural networks and diffusion transformer (DiT) architecture to create what the team called “digital brushstrokes” that captured the textures and colors of different artistic styles. The result featured iconic landmarks like Guangzhou’s Canton Tower, the Hong Kong-Zhuhai-Macao Bridge, and Macau’s Ruins of St. Paul’s.
This marked the first time AI collective intelligence was featured at a major international sporting event. The system’s creative director noted that the 174-meter artwork represented “the convergence of technology and art in the AI era.”
